5 Vietnamese delicacies in the top 100 most attractive street foods in Asia

TH (according to Vietnam+) May 28, 2024 14:45

International culinary website TasteAtlas has announced a list of 100 most attractive street foods in Asia, in which Vietnam is present with 5 delicious dishes including banh mi, pho, broken rice, spring rolls and banh xeo.

Banh mi, pho, broken rice, spring rolls and banh xeo are five Vietnamese delicacies that have made it onto the list of 100 most attractive street foods in Asia, announced by international culinary website TasteAtlas.

Coming in at number 3, banh mi is not only a familiar dish to Vietnamese people but is also extremely loved by international diners. Banh mi is unique in its appearance, flavor, preparation method and variety of ingredients.

Normally, a sandwich includes meat such as pork, beef, grilled meat, ham, sausage, eggs, pate, sausage... served with cucumber, pickles, herbs, chili sauce, soy sauce... depending on preference. The special spices and the harmonious combination of ingredients are the secrets to the popularity of sandwiches.

Bread in each place has its own unique flavor, take the time to explore and enjoy the diversity in each region and locality where you pass through.

Ranked at number 6 on the list, broken rice is a popular dish in Southern Vietnam, one of the famous street foods domestically and internationally.

Broken rice according to the recipe is made from broken rice - a type of broken rice, served with many side dishes such as grilled meat, fried eggs, egg rolls, shredded pork skin..., adding chopped green onions, tomatoes, cucumbers and pickled vegetables, drizzled with fish sauce, garlic and chili.

Visitors can easily find broken rice restaurants from affordable to luxurious all over the streets with the image of smoky outdoor charcoal stoves and the characteristic aroma of grilled meat.

Pho is indispensable in this list - the essence of Vietnamese cuisine. This is a dish favored by international tourists because of its delicate, characteristic, and unique flavor.

Pho is ranked 10th in the list.

Pho traditionally has a broth made from simmered bones with spices and herbs such as cinnamon, star anise, and cardamom. The noodles are placed in a bowl of hot broth, with meats such as chicken breast, thigh, beef brisket, beef shank, well-done or rare beef brisket, stir-fried. Garnish with green onions, herbs, fried breadsticks, lemon, chili, etc. according to taste.

The unique appeal of pho lies in the spices and herbs, which are both rich in flavor and light and delicate.

Ranked 24th on the list, spring rolls (as they are called in the South) or fried spring rolls (as they are called in the North) are a dish wrapped in rice paper and fried until golden brown. The dish is relatively simple to make, just wrap ingredients such as minced meat, shrimp, eggs, vermicelli, wood ear mushrooms, shiitake mushrooms, carrots, etc. in a rice paper, then fry until golden brown on all sides and drain the oil.

Spring rolls have an eye-catching outer shell, crispy on the outside, soft and juicy on the inside, dipped in sweet and sour sauce to create an irresistible taste.

Besides the traditional fillings, people also prepare the dish in many different ways such as seafood spring rolls, fish spring rolls, or vegetarian spring rolls... Spring rolls can be used as both a main dish and an appetizer in a meal.

Banh xeo is ranked 43rd on the list, is an attractive and popular snack of Vietnam, combined with many delicious fresh ingredients. Banh xeo crust is made from rice flour, has a bright yellow color of turmeric, the aroma of coconut milk. The filling usually includes shrimp, stir-fried or diced minced meat, bean sprouts.

When the batter is poured into a pan of boiling oil, it makes a “sizzling” sound - just like the name of the cake. The dish is usually rolled with vegetables, lettuce, herbs and dipped in sweet and sour fish sauce.

This is not the first time Vietnamese cuisine has been named in the list of the most famous dishes in the world and Asia.

Recently, the famous culinary website Taste Atlas also announced that banh mi ranked first in the ranking of the 100 best sandwiches in the world, with a rating of 4.6/5 stars.

In 2023, in the list of 50 most attractive street foods in Asia listed by CNN, traditional Vietnamese cuisine had 3 dishes on this list: banh mi, pho and iced coffee.
